Kotra Industries Bhd  (XKLS:0002) Earnings per Share (Diluted) Explanation

Earnings Per Share (EPS) is the single most important variable used by Wall Street in determining the earnings power of a company. But investors need to be aware that Earnings per Share can be easily manipulated by adjusting depreciation and amortization rate or non-recurring items. That's why GuruFocus lists EPS without NRI, which better reflects the company's underlying performance.


Be Aware

Compared with Earnings per share, a company's cash flow is better indicator of the company's earnings power.

If a company's earnings per share is less than cash flow per share over long term, investors need to be cautious and find out why.

Kotra Industries Bhd Business Description

Address Jalan TTC 12, No. 1, 2 & 3, Cheng Industrial Estate, Melaka, MYS, 75250
Kotra Industries Bhd is a Malaysian pharmaceutical company engaged in the development, manufacturing, and supply of pharmaceutical and healthcare products supporting all life stages. Its portfolio includes life-saving medicines, OTC supplements, and nutrition products. The Group markets three core brands: Appeton, offering health supplements and nutrition across all age groups; Vaxcel, providing injectable medicines for infectious diseases, kidney care, and gastroenterology; and Axcel, specializing in oral and topical medicines for paediatrics, dermatology, and infectious diseases. The company operates in Malaysia and overseas, with the majority of revenue derived from Malaysia.
